![]() ![]() First the speed is quite slow, but it eventually increases. ![]() A person has to run continuously between two marked lines that are 20 m apart and has to follow the recorded beeps (hence the name of the test). Beep test – 20 m distanceĪlso known as the 20 meter shuttle run test, bleep test, pacer test or Leger-test, the bleep test (distances and times are essential) is a multi-stage fitness test, used by sports coaches or PE teachers to estimate their athlete’s maximum oxygen uptake (VO 2 max).
